At Job&Talent, we are recruiting for a Food Production Operative Evenings to work with a leading company in the food sector in Linton.
Shift Patterns: Monday to Friday from 5.30 pm to 2 am
Pay Rates: £14.15 hourly
Requirements for Food Production Operative Evenings:
- Own transport is required due to the site's location.
- No qualifications needed.
- Processing and packing products to required orders, including mixing, blending, packing, and labelling of fresh meat products, including pork meat.
- Being available to work full-time for a long-term assignment.
Desirable requirements for Food Production Operative Evenings:
- Familiarity with working in a temperature-controlled, food manufacturing environment.
- Team player with good communication skills.
Role for Food Production Operative Evenings:
- Set up and operate production machinery safely and efficiently.
- Monitor product quality and adhere to strict food safety standards.
- Maintain a clean and organized workspace in line with hygiene regulations.
- Assist with the packing and labelling of finished products.
Benefits for Food Production Operative Evenings:
- Competitive hourly pay rate with potential for overtime.
- Comprehensive training and support provided from day one.
- Opportunity to work in a modern, temperature-controlled facility.
- Long-term career stability with a leading employer.
